On Friday 31 October 2003 12:49 pm, Joseph A. Nagy, Jr. wrote:
> Doh! I've already started the bootstrap process. I imagine it's too
> late?

Bootstrap.sh only compiles glibc and gcc (multiple times.) AFAIK, neither of 
these uses gpg encryption. As long as you put this in USE= before emerge'ing 
any other software that uses encryption, you will still be OK.
